
Nova Rae
Channel
672,078672.1k video views
672.1k views
1.9k
1.9k
Country: USA
Profile hits: 70,899
Subscribers: 1,894
Total video views: 672,078
Signed up: December 31, 2021 (1,169 days ago)
Worked for/with: Nova Rae